ROCHESTER, N.Y., May 27 Eastman Kodak Company (NYSE:EK), a pioneer in Organic Light Emitting Diode
technology (OLED), has been awarded a $1.7 million two-year contract by the
United States Department of Energy (DOE) to develop key technologies and
processes for OLED lighting panels. During the Product Development phase of the
Solid State Lighting project, Kodak will develop an OLED luminaire that meets
Energy Star color and efficacy specifications and will address key areas of
manufacturing processes to reduce cost. Kodak’s Vapor Injection Source
Technology allows manufacturers to significantly reduce unit-manufacturing
costs, with high manufacturing throughput and material utilization that
initially exceeds 50%, and could be greater than 75% in future manufacturing
applications.
